AN EGYPTIAN CARNELIAN AMULET OF THOTH
NEW KINGDOM, CIRCA 1550-1069 B.C.
Depicted squatting with paws on its knees, with thick finely detailed mane, wearing full moon and crescent headdress, pierced for suspension
¾ in. (2 cm.) high
Provenance
Formerly in an English private collection, 1978.
